Travel disrupted by nor’easter snow and wind in Nova Scotia
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ter



Snow clearing operations are in progress across Nova Scotia following a nor’easter that brought heavy snow and high winds. The Halifax Regional Municipality is prioritizing the clearance of main roads and sidewalks, urging residents to avoid non-essential travel to facilitate cleanup. Winter parking bans are in effect overnight, and many flights have been canceled while schools closed early. Snowfall totals are expected to reach 15 to 40 centimeters in various areas, with strong winds causing reduced visibility and potential power outages.
